Marcus Dill is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Marcus Dill has authored 9 papers receiving a total of 313 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 4 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and 2 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Marcus Dill’s work include Visual perception and processing mechanisms (7 papers), Neurobiology and Insect Physiology Research (4 papers) and Face Recognition and Perception (3 papers). Marcus Dill is often cited by papers focused on Visual perception and processing mechanisms (7 papers), Neurobiology and Insect Physiology Research (4 papers) and Face Recognition and Perception (3 papers). Marcus Dill collaborates with scholars based in United States, Germany and United Kingdom. Marcus Dill's co-authors include Martin Heisenberg, Manfred Fahle, Reinhard Wolf, Shimon Edelman, Ronni Wolf, Katherine G. Rendahl, Harald Saumweber and Ralf Stanewsky and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Genetics and Philosophical Transactions of the Royal Society B Biological Sciences.
